
The execution of a search warrant following investigation of drug trafficking has led to the arrest of six Lincoln Parish residents.
The Lincoln Parish Narcotics Enforcement Team, accompanied by Ruston Police SWAT and the Lincoln Parish Special Response Team, executed a search warrant on a Virgil Road residence near Dubach Tuesday morning.

The raid was part of an investigation by LPNET into methamphetamine sales by several individuals living at the residence. The investigation led to the issuance of arrest warrants for allegedly distributing methamphetamine by Tanya Gray, 44; Kristyn D. Wright, 34; and Jonath Caleb Patton, 48; all residents of the Virgil Road location.
After officers arrived at the scene, two individuals came outside. After numerous directives two other occupants to come out without success, a door into the house was breached and Patton, Gray, and another individual were found inside and were taken into custody.
Suspected methamphetamine, marijuana, and property stolen in a burglary were found during the search. The search of a second structure on the premises, allegedly used by Jesse Flowers, 39, revealed additional stolen property, suspected methamphetamine, marijuana, and drug paraphernalia.
Flowers and Angela Sanderson, 45, arrived during the search and were taken into custody as well.
